Hi,

whenever i play a fullscreen game (like BF5; SW:BF2) and quit the game my screen turns black and my pc resets after 10 sec~ (after kernel dump). Maybe some of the expert's here have an idea why.

I have exactly the same issue, computer restarts / crashes after playing Fifa 20 or BFV as soon as i quit the game it crashes. 

Your crash dump pretty much the same as mine. If you look at it you will see "atikmdag.sys" this is the AMD graphics driver referenced. The exception is a Double Fault, which means an exception handler was not able to handle an exception that was thrown. I have tried to analyze it and it shows the graphics driver atikmdag crashing, however i couldn't get to the bottom of why exactly. Someone from AMD engineers need to look at this dump
